Comparison of Damage Effect between Focusing Warhead and Ordinary Blast Fragmentation Warhead

Focused on effectively damaging air targets, a damage effect comparison between focusing warhead and conventional blast fragmentation warhead was researched. The simulation system of damage assessment of fragment warhead to air target was devel-oped. Using the system, the number of fragments hit on the missile was calculated and the damage under the same initial ammuni-tion target interaction conditions was shown. The number of fragments hit on missile by focusing warhead is much more than hit by conventional blast fragmentation warhead, and the focusing warhead can cause cutting damage. The simulation experiment was conducted to compare synergetic damage effect of combined blast and fragments of focusing warhead and conventional blast frag-mentation warhead. Damage efficiency of focusing warhead is much higher. The research method and research results can supply reference to deep study of focusing warhead.
